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PM2BP4_Strong

The NM_024913.5(CPED1):c.659G>A(p.Gly220Glu)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000205 in 1,461,544 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ingAmbry GeneticsMar 07, 2023The c.659G>A (p.G220E) alteration is located in exon 6 (coding exon 5) of the CPED1 gene. This alteration results from a G to A substitution at nucleotide position 659, causing the glycine (G) at amino acid position 220 to be replaced by a glutamic acid (E).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
